Manual upgrade of VRTSvlic package loses keyless product levels If you upgrade the VRTSvlic package manually, the product levels that were set using vxkeyless may be lost.
The output of the vxkeyless display command will not display correctly. To prevent this, perform the following steps while manually upgrading the VRTSvlic package. To manually upgrade the VRTSvlic package 1. Note down the list of products configured on the node for keyless licensing. Set the product level to NONE. Upgrade the VRTSvlic package. Restore the list of products that you noted in step 1. As a result, you may see periodic reminders being logged if the VOM server is not configured.

A volume's placement class tags are not visible in the Veritas Enterprise Administrator GUI when creating a dynamic storage tiering placement policy A volume's placement class tags are not visible in the Veritas Enterprise Administrator VEA GUI when you are creating a dynamic storage tiering DST placement policy if you do not tag the volume with the placement classes prior to constructing a volume set for the volume.
If you already constructed the volume set before tagging the volumes, restart vxsvc to make the tags visible in the GUI. For example, if you deport one dg1, minor number x1 of two shared disk groups, and reminor the other dg2, minor number x2 with About Veritas Storage Foundation and High Availability Solutions Known Issues 89 x1, the system allows the action without displaying any error messages.
As a consequence, dg1 and dg2 have the same minor number. Workaround: When you try to reminor, do not use the base minor number that is assigned to another disk group.
And whenever you create a disk group, create some objects in it to avoid accidental reuse of its base minor number. Node join can lead to hang if an upgrade of the cluster protocol version is in progress If you attempt to join a node to the cluster while Cluster Volume Manager CVM is upgrading the cluster protocol version, the system may hang.
This issue occurs if the node is attempting to join the cluster after you issue the vxdctl upgrade command to upgrade the CVM cluster. Work-around: Avoid joining a new node to the cluster until the CVM cluster upgrade is completed.

It is recommended to maintain the VRTSvxvm version as 5. Node not able to join when recovery is in progress When a node leaves a cluster, there is an associated volume recovery for the leaving node. It is not allowed to join any node to the cluster during the recovery because the nodeid of the leaving node cannot be assigned to the joining node.
